Our problem for the day… What is the percent composition of Calcium Chloride??

But first…what exactly is percent composition? In chemistry class we define it as “the percentage by mass of each element in a compound.” The mass percentage of an element in a compound is the same regardless of the sample’s size

Percent Composition Formula Mass of element in compound % element in compound X 100 = Mass of Compound

Class Example: Calculate the percent composition by mass of each element in calcium chloride: CaCl2

Your first step is to find the Atomic masses of the elements in the compound…look at the periodic table

Your Second Step is to determine the total masses of each element and of the compound. To make things easier, we are going to round the atomic masses to the nearest tenth of a gram. So Calcium’s atomic mass is 40.1grams and Chlorine’s atomic mass is 35.5 grams! Now we add the Calcium and Chlorine together BUT because we have two chlorines we have to multiply Chlorine’s atomic mass by 2! Ca (40.1 grams) + Cl2 (71.0 grams) = 111.1 grams for the mass of CaCl2

Last step: This is the big one! Mass of calcium (Ca) % calcium in compound X 100 = Mass of calcium chloride (CaCl2) 40.1 grams 36.1 % calcium in compound X 100 = 111.1 grams

Can you calculate the chlorine on your own?? Mass of chlorine (Cl) % chlorine in compound X 100 = Mass of calcium chloride (CaCl2) 71.1 grams 63.9 % calcium in compound X 100 = 111.1 grams
